Frequently asked questions

How many cruise ports does Norway have?
Major cruise itineraries regularly visit 15+ ports on our authority site, from southern Kristiansand to Arctic Honningsvåg.
Which Norway ports are UNESCO fjords?
Geiranger, Flåm (Nærøyfjord branch) and surrounding fjord transit routes are UNESCO listed waters on many sailings.
